Alonso accident aftermath mystery brewing

Fernando Alonso's rivals were surprised on Thursday when it emerged the Spaniard had been sidelined in Bahrain for medical reasons. 'I said ‘Wow',' admitted fellow F1 veteran Jenson Button. Alonso's countryman and friend Carlos Sainz added: 'I knew he was not 100 per cent, but I did not expect that he would not race. I think it was a surprise for everyone.' Esteban Gutierrez, who was involved in Alonso's high-speed crash in Melbourne, agreed: 'I was with him after the accident and happy that everything with his health was ok. Then I heard on Monday that he was not 100pc but I'm sure he will recover soon.'
